Output c30271bc14d8b780dde06c58e91fda1e6bed2487f74e7eceb888407f3010a661:2

value
98356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 943520367123438372aeda52fbdc33ddfe2f7a19 OP_EQUAL
address
3FCfaBWnr1w37b2ikxij1KgXpJiPfRjPFF
transaction
c30271bc14d8b780dde06c58e91fda1e6bed2487f74e7eceb888407f3010a661
confirmations
72806
spent
true